Police officer detained for drinking on duty

Share

A named police officer from Magoye police post, who was found drunk on duty, has been detained at Mazabuka Police station. This follows orders by Magoye Member of Parliament, Bennie Mweemba, to have the officer punished.

Both police and Mr Mweemba confirmed the detention of the officer to ZANIS in Mazabuka today.

Mr Mweemba said he ordered the detention of the officer because he found him drunk and unable to perform his duties while complainants waited for a long time without being attended to.

He said he will not tolerate indiscipline among police officers especially those that drink beer on duty.
Mr Mweemba said the officer will only be released from custody tomorrow.

“This chap ran away from me as I attempted to bundle him in my car. So what I did was to phone the Officer in charge who complained of fuel but I had to provide them with fuel in order for them to pick him. He will only be discharged tomorrow,’’ said Mweemba.

He also urged the Inspector General of Police to ensure that police officers reporting for work while drunk are fired because they are denting the good image of the police service.

Mazabuka District Commissioner, Tyson Hamaamba, also confirmed the development and said he would only issue a detailed report after receiving a police report.

Mazabula police station is another station where some police officers report for work drunk.
